China’s Perfect Field in $1.8 bln Singapore Solar Deal

Singapore [Reuters] Chinese solar energy group Perfect Field Investment said it would take over Singapore’s Rowsley in a deal worth S$2.7 billion ($1.8 billion) to fund its expansion as demand for renewable energy products grows. The company will produce solar modules, solar cells and panels.
